The project: # GG24-60049
In the Ashanti region of central Ghana, drilling of 36 fresh water wells, construction of 376 composting microflush toilets and granting of 134 microloans that will enable communities to double and then triple the infrastructure through a second and third cycle of expansion.
This project, with a total cost of $273,000, will bring drinking water and sanitation to over 38,000 beneficiaries.
